Apple Expected To Showcase IPhone 8 Next Month.

SEOUL, (U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News - 29th Aug, 2017 ) : U.S. tech giant Apple Inc. is widely expected to showcase its new iPhone in September, industry sources said Tuesday, staging a face-to-face battle with samsung Electronics Co.'s Galaxy Note 8, which will also hit shelves next month.
According to the sources, Apple will showcase the presumed iPhone 8 on Sept. 12, with the official release expected to start within a week from the showcase event. The new iPhone, accordingly, is expected to engage in a fierce competition with Samsung's Galaxy Note 8, which will be available in the market starting Sept.
15. Samsung showcased the 6.3-inch Galaxy Note 8 last week with a dual- camera and improved stylus features. Critics claim the device will help Samsung fully recover its tainted image from the ill-fated Galaxy Note 7, whose production was suspended last year over faulty batteries.
Industry tracker Strategy Analytics said Samsung is expected to ship 10 million units of the Galaxy Note 8 this year and help the company solidify its stance in the Android segment. The researcher, however, said the phablet's sales are unlikely to beat the new iPhone.
